The Optigan Archives Vol. 1 Sample DVD-R!
YouTube via peahix
"This video features a series of very simple demos of sounds from the Optigan Archives Vol. 1 Sample DVD-R, compared with their related sounds from the Optigan/Orchestron/Talentmaker sample CD. (Please see http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=aeUeME... for an infomercial for that CD.)
This is an exclusive set of loops and keyboard samples culled from the original Optigan/Orchestron studio master reels.
While the Optigan itself always sounded very lo-fi due to the limitations of its optical-soundtrack technology, the original master tapes retain their hi-fi sound quality (albeit in mono).
The Optigan master reels are a vast archive of early 1970s era musical building blocks, covering a wide range of popular styles from the period. Ultimately, only a small portion of this material ever made it onto production Optigan discs. For this initial collection of samples, I'm focusing on that small portion and related out-takes. Future volumes in this series will comprise entirely unfamiliar material- out-takes which never saw the light of day on any Optigan disc.
